Brandon M. Parham, MBA currently serves as the Vice President of Preconstruction at Carmel Partners, overseeing the preconstruction process for large-scale residential developments in Southern California. Prior to their current role, Brandon held positions as Director and Manager of Preconstruction at Suffolk Construction and as an Estimator at Del Amo Construction, Inc. Brandon holds an MBA from Pepperdine Graziadio Business School and a Bachelor of Science in Biomedical Engineering from California Polytechnic State University-San Luis Obispo. Brandon is currently pursuing a Master of Real Estate in Finance from Georgetown University School of Continuing Studies.

Founded in 1996, Carmel Partners is one of the nation’s leading specialists in real estate investment management, focusing on U.S. multifamily development and construction, and opportunistically, debt. Carmel seeks superior risk-adjusted returns across varying market cycles, executed through its vertically integrated platform in supply-constrained, high barrier-to-entry markets in the U.S. Since the firm’s founding, Carmel has bought and renovated or developed, or is in the process of renovating or developing, more than 43,000 apartment units with an estimated value in excess of $13.5 billion. Headquartered in San Francisco, Carmel has offices in Los Angeles, New York, Seattle, Denver and Washington, D.C.
